Carmel High School is a public school for students in grades 9-12 in Carmel, IN and is served by the Carmel Clay Schools in Indiana. Annual tuition is $0. The school has a total enrollment of 5,200 and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 17:1. Academic records show that 69% of students achieve proficiency in math, and 84% are proficient in reading. Carmel High School has received feedback and ratings, with a Niche grade of A+ and a GreatSchools Rating of 10 out of 10. The average GPA is 3.62, the graduation rate is 98%, and average standardized test scores include an SAT score of 1300 and an ACT score of 30. The average home value in this area is $439,388.
